198 NGC XF Geta Roman Empire Denarius Caesar Dynasty Pedigree (21070903C) Hungary Victory advancing left holding wreathCaesar Geta Roman Empire silver denarius coin. Issued 198 CE while Caesar under Emperor Septimius Severus (his Father). Approx. 19mm, 3. 10g, RIC 3 variety, RSC 188 variety, Foss 1 (attributed to 198 CE). Certified by NGC to XF. Good portrait of Geta as a boy. Draped Cuirassed bust apparently not listed by RIC or RSC. Historic type issued to commemorate the Proclamation of Geta as Caesar & the celebration of the new Severan Dynasty. Pedigree: Ex.
